假定int类型变量占用两个字节,其有定义:int a[5]={0,1};,则数组a在内存中所占字节数是
A.2 B.
以下程序的输出结果是( )
void main( )
{ float x=2, y;
if (x<0) y=0;
else if(x<5&&!x) y=1/(x+2);
else if(x<10) y=1/x;
else y=10;
printf("%f\n",y);}
A、0.000000 B、
设有如下定义: char *a[2]={"ABC","123"}; 则以下就法中正确的是 。
A.a数组成元素的值分别是"ABC"和"123"
B.a是指针变量,它指向含有两个数组元素的字符型一维数组
C.a数组的两个元素中各自存放了字符'A'和'1'的地址
D.a数组的两个元素分别存放的是含有3个字符的一维字符数组的首地址
main(){
int k=0, x,num ;
scanf("%d",);
for (x=num; k<; x++)
if (){
k++;
printf("%10d",x);
}
执行下面的程序时,从键盘上输入5和2,则输出结果是 ( )
main()
{int a,b,k;
Scanf(“%d%d”,&a,&b);
k=a;
if(a
else k=b%a;
printf(“%d\n”,k);}
A 5 B 3 C 2 D 0